Hi and welcome to my home page. My name is John Lionarons and I live right outside of Philadelphia, PA  USA.
I think I must be one of the luckiest people I know because I play music for a living.  Though it is something of a mixed
blessing to wear all the many hats listed above.  On the one hand it takes a lot of time and effort to stay proficient at
so many things; on the other hand I rarely get bored.  And I DO seem to be working all the time.  I've also had the
chance to meet and work with some very talented people.

I'm best known around these parts as a dulcimer player since I've brought back 3 trophies (and prize dulcimers) from the
NATIONAL HAMMERED DULCIMER CHAMPIONSHIPS in Winfield, KS.  But in the past few years I've been
spending an increasing amount of time writing and performing music for a number of professional theater companies.
A tremendous thrill for me last year was being nominated for a BARRYMORE AWARD (it's like a Tony but in the
shape a cheesesteak) for Best Original Musical Score for BEAUTY AND THE BEAST at  PEOPLES' LIGHT AND THEATRE COMPANY (Malvern, PA).
